Body Composition

Body composition refers to the proportion of fat, muscle, bones, and organs in the human body. It is an important aspect of physical fitness and plays a significant role in determining overall health and well-being. Body composition can be assessed through various methods such as skinfold measurements, bioelectrical impedance analysis, dual-energy X-ray absorptiometry (DEXA), and underwater weighing.

Comparison of Weight

When comparing the weight of fat in the body to the weight of bones, muscles, and organs, it falls under the concept of body composition. The weight of fat is often expressed as a percentage of the total body weight. On the other hand, the weight of bones, muscles, and organs collectively makes up the lean body mass.

Significance of Body Composition

Understanding body composition is crucial because it provides valuable insights into an individual's overall health and fitness level. Here are a few reasons why body composition matters:

1. Health Risks: Excessive fat accumulation in the body, especially around vital organs, can increase the risk of various health conditions such as heart disease, diabetes, and hypertension. Monitoring body composition helps identify individuals who may be at a higher risk and need to make changes to their lifestyle.

2. Weight Management: Body composition analysis helps in determining whether an individual's weight is predominantly due to muscle or fat. This information is essential for setting realistic weight loss or weight gain goals and designing appropriate exercise and nutrition plans.

3. Performance Assessment: Body composition analysis is commonly used in sports and fitness settings to evaluate an individual's athletic performance. Athletes may need to maintain a certain level of muscle mass while minimizing excessive fat to enhance their performance.

4. Tracking Progress: By regularly monitoring body composition, individuals can track their progress over time and make necessary adjustments to their exercise and diet routines. It provides a more accurate reflection of changes happening inside the body compared to simply relying on weight measurements.

5. Motivation: Seeing positive changes in body composition, such as a decrease in fat percentage and an increase in muscle mass, can serve as a motivating factor for individuals striving to improve their physical fitness and overall health.

In conclusion, body composition refers to the distribution of fat, muscle, bones, and organs in the body. Comparing the weight of fat to the weight of bones, muscles, and organs falls under the concept of body composition. Understanding body composition is important for assessing overall health, managing weight, evaluating athletic performance, tracking progress, and staying motivated on the fitness journey.

Muscular Strength
Muscular strength refers to the amount of force a muscle or group of muscles can exert during a single maximal effort. It is a key component of physical fitness and is crucial for performing daily activities, sports, and preventing injuries.

Importance of Muscular Strength
- Muscular strength is essential for maintaining good posture and balance.
- It helps in the prevention of injuries, especially in sports and physical activities.
- Strong muscles contribute to overall physical performance and endurance.
- Muscular strength is necessary for carrying out activities of daily living, such as lifting, pushing, and pulling objects.

Factors Affecting Muscular Strength
- Genetics play a role in determining an individual's potential for muscular strength.
- Training and exercise programs can significantly increase muscular strength.
- Nutrition and adequate protein intake are crucial for muscle growth and strength.
- Age and gender also influence muscular strength, with males generally having greater strength due to higher levels of testosterone.

Improving Muscular Strength
- Resistance training, such as weightlifting, is one of the most effective ways to increase muscular strength.
- Progressive overload, gradually increasing the weight or resistance used during training, is key to building strength.
- Proper form and technique are essential to prevent injuries and maximize the benefits of strength training.
- Adequate rest and recovery are necessary for muscle growth and strength development.
In conclusion, muscular strength is the amount of force muscles can apply when being used and is crucial for overall physical performance and well-being. By incorporating strength training into your fitness routine and focusing on proper nutrition and rest, you can improve your muscular strength and enjoy the numerous benefits it offers.

Understanding Flexibility
Flexibility is a crucial component of physical fitness that refers to the range of motion through a joint. It is essential for overall movement efficiency and injury prevention.
What is Flexibility?
- Flexibility is the ability of muscles and joints to move through their full range of motion.
- It varies among individuals and can be influenced by factors such as age, gender, physical activity level, and muscle temperature.
Importance of Flexibility
- Injury Prevention: Enhanced flexibility can reduce the risk of injuries by allowing joints to move freely and efficiently.
- Improved Performance: Athletes often require greater flexibility to enhance their performance in sports by executing movements more effectively.
- Posture and Alignment: Good flexibility contributes to better posture, which can alleviate discomfort in the back and neck.
Types of Flexibility
- Static Flexibility: The ability to hold a stretch at a particular position. For example, a split or a forward bend.
- Dynamic Flexibility: The ability to perform active movements that require flexibility, such as leg swings or lunges.
Ways to Improve Flexibility
- Stretching Exercises: Regular stretching routines, including static and dynamic stretches, can enhance flexibility.
- Yoga and Pilates: These practices focus on controlled movements and stretches that improve flexibility and strength.
- Warm-Up Activities: Engaging in a proper warm-up before physical activity increases muscle temperature and elasticity.
In conclusion, flexibility is vital for maintaining a healthy body and enhancing athletic performance, making it a key aspect of physical fitness.

Overview of Physical Fitness Components
Physical fitness is a comprehensive term that encompasses various attributes that contribute to overall health and performance. The generally accepted model identifies five key components of physical fitness.
1. Cardiovascular Endurance
- Refers to the ability of the heart and lungs to supply oxygen to the muscles during prolonged physical activity.
- Essential for activities such as running, swimming, and cycling.
2. Muscular Strength
- Defines the maximum amount of force that a muscle or group of muscles can generate.
- Important for tasks that require lifting heavy objects or performing high-intensity exercises.
3. Muscular Endurance
- The capacity of a muscle or group of muscles to perform repeated contractions over time without fatigue.
- Critical for activities like rowing or long-distance cycling.
4. Flexibility
- Measures the range of motion of joints and muscles.
- Enhances performance and reduces the risk of injuries during physical activities.
5. Body Composition
- Refers to the proportion of fat and non-fat mass in the body.
- A healthy body composition is critical for overall well-being and physical performance.
Conclusion
Understanding these five components of physical fitness helps individuals set realistic fitness goals, design effective workout programs, and improve overall health. Each component plays a vital role in enhancing performance and maintaining a balanced lifestyle.

Muscular Endurance

Muscular endurance is the ability to perform repetitive muscular contractions against some resistance for an extended period of time. It is a crucial component of fitness that helps an individual to withstand muscular fatigue and perform physical tasks for a prolonged period of time. The ability to overcome resistance is an important aspect of muscular endurance.

Importance of Muscular Endurance

Muscular endurance is important for various reasons. Some of them are:

1. It helps in maintaining good posture and reducing the risk of injury.

2. It enhances the ability to perform daily activities without getting tired easily.

3. It improves the performance of athletes in sports that require prolonged physical activity.

4. It supports cardiovascular health by improving blood flow and reducing the risk of heart disease.

5. It helps in weight management by burning calories and improving metabolic rate.

6. It enhances overall fitness and well-being.

Ways to Improve Muscular Endurance

There are various ways to improve muscular endurance. Some of them are:

1. Resistance training: Resistance training involves performing exercises with weights or resistance bands that challenge the muscles to work harder. It helps in building muscular endurance by increasing the number of repetitions performed.

2. Circuit training: Circuit training involves performing a series of exercises with short rest periods in between. It improves muscular endurance by challenging the muscles to work continuously.

3. High-intensity interval training (HIIT): HIIT involves performing short bursts of intense exercise followed by a period of rest. It helps in building muscular endurance by improving the ability to recover quickly between bouts of exercise.

4. Aerobic exercise: Aerobic exercise such as running, cycling, or swimming helps in building muscular endurance by improving cardiovascular health and oxygen uptake.

Conclusion

Muscular endurance is an important component of fitness that helps in performing physical tasks for a prolonged period of time. The ability to overcome resistance is a crucial aspect of muscular endurance. By incorporating resistance training, circuit training, HIIT, and aerobic exercise into the fitness routine, one can improve muscular endurance and enhance overall fitness and well-being.

The suppleness is called flexibility

Flexibility is the ability of the muscles and joints to move through a full range of motion without any discomfort or pain. It is an important component of physical fitness that is often overlooked but plays a crucial role in overall health and performance.

Importance of flexibility

- Flexibility helps improve posture, reduce the risk of injuries, and enhance athletic performance.
- It allows for better mobility and coordination, making everyday tasks easier to perform.
- Flexibility also helps in preventing muscle imbalances and can alleviate muscle tightness and soreness.

Factors affecting flexibility

- Age: Flexibility tends to decrease with age due to a decrease in the elasticity of muscles and tendons.
- Gender: Generally, females tend to be more flexible than males due to differences in muscle and tendon structure.
- Physical activity: Regular stretching and exercises that promote flexibility can improve range of motion.

Ways to improve flexibility

- Stretching: Regular stretching exercises such as yoga, Pilates, or simple stretches can help improve flexibility.
- Warm-up: Always warm up before engaging in any physical activity to prepare the muscles for movement.
- Balance training: Exercises that focus on balance and stability can also help improve flexibility.

Conclusion

Flexibility is an important aspect of physical fitness that should not be neglected. By incorporating stretching exercises and maintaining an active lifestyle, one can improve flexibility, reduce the risk of injuries, and enhance overall well-being.

Understanding Aerobic Exercise
Aerobic exercise refers to physical activities that require sustained effort over an extended period, primarily utilizing oxygen to fuel the body. This type of exercise is essential for improving cardiovascular health and endurance.
Characteristics of Aerobic Exercise:
- Duration and Intensity: Aerobic exercises are typically performed at a moderate intensity for a longer duration, usually exceeding 20-30 minutes.
- Oxygen Use: These exercises rely on oxygen to generate energy, making them efficient for prolonged activities.
- Examples: Common forms of aerobic exercise include running, swimming, cycling, and dancing.
Benefits of Aerobic Exercise:
- Cardiovascular Health: Enhances heart and lung function, improving overall fitness and stamina.
- Weight Management: Helps in burning calories, aiding in weight loss or maintenance.
- Mental Health: Releases endorphins, reducing stress and anxiety while boosting mood.
- Endurance Building: Increases the body’s capability to sustain physical activity over long periods.
Comparison with Anaerobic Exercise:
- Anaerobic Exercise: Involves short bursts of high-intensity activity, like weightlifting or sprinting, where oxygen is less utilized.
- Energy Systems: While aerobic exercise uses the aerobic energy system, anaerobic exercise relies on energy production without oxygen, leading to quicker fatigue.
In summary, aerobic exercise is crucial for long-term health and fitness, characterized by its reliance on oxygen and ability to enhance endurance over extended periods. Emphasizing aerobic activities in your routine can lead to significant health benefits.
